The Critical Role of Explosion Proof Lighting in Paint Spray Booths

Paint spray booths are essential environments in industries ranging from automotive refinishing to aerospace manufacturing. However, they are also inherently hazardous. The presence of flammable vapors, combustible dust, and volatile organic compounds (VOCs) means that every piece of equipment inside the booth must be meticulously designed to prevent ignition.

Among these, explosion proof lighting stands as one of the most critical components for ensuring both safety and operational efficiency. At GRINSAFE, we engineer lighting solutions specifically designed to perform reliably in these demanding environments.

Why Standard Lighting Fails

In conventional environments, lighting fixtures may generate sparks due to loose electrical connections or excessive heat from overloaded circuits. In a paint booth, where solvents such as toluene and acetone saturate the air, even a minor spark can act as an ignition source.

Explosion-proof lighting eliminates this risk through containment and isolation. GRINSAFE fixtures are constructed using heavy-duty, copper-free aluminum alloy housings designed to withstand internal explosions. Any ignition occurring inside the fixture is contained, while engineered flame paths cool and extinguish hot gases before they can reach the external hazardous atmosphere.

The LED Advantage in Hazardous Locations

The transition from traditional lighting technologies to LED has significantly improved safety and performance in hazardous areas. Unlike fluorescent or HID lamps, LED fixtures operate at much lower surface temperatures.

GRINSAFE explosion-proof LED luminaires are designed to meet stringent T-Code ratings, with many achieving T6 (≤85°C). This ensures surface temperatures remain well below the auto-ignition points of most paints and solvents used in spray applications.

Additionally, LED technology offers:

  • No fragile glass tubes, reducing contamination risk
  • High resistance to vibration from ventilation systems
  • Long lifespan, minimizing maintenance in hazardous areas

Built for Harsh Chemical Environments

Paint spray booths are not only explosive but also highly corrosive. Overspray containing isocyanates and aggressive chemicals can degrade standard materials over time.

GRINSAFE lighting solutions are engineered with durability in mind, featuring:

  • Epoxy-polyester powder-coated housings for superior corrosion resistance
  • Silicone-free gaskets to prevent chemical degradation
  • Sealed enclosures that protect against moisture and solvent ingress

This robust construction ensures long-term reliability while maintaining the integrity of the explosion-proof enclosure.

Enhancing Quality and Productivity

Beyond safety, lighting plays a vital role in achieving high-quality finishes. GRINSAFE explosion-proof fixtures incorporate high-CRI LED technology (CRI ≥90), enabling accurate color rendering and detailed surface inspection.

This allows operators to easily identify imperfections such as:

  • Orange peel texture
  • Fish eyes
  • Uneven coating

Improved visibility reduces rework, enhances efficiency, and ensures consistent finishing quality.
